How much do digital marketing project man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average yearly pay for digital marketing project manager in Santa Rosa, CA is $108,623.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$76,500.00 and $134,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a digital marketing project manager?

A Digital Marketing Project Manager oversees the planning, execution, and delivery of digital marketing campaigns. They coordinate teams, manage timelines and budgets, and ensure strategies align with business goals. Their role involves working with SEO, PPC, social media, content marketing, and analytics to drive engagement and conversions. Strong communication, organization, and analytical skills are essential for success in this role.

What does a digital marketing project manager do?

A typical day for a Digital Marketing Project Manager involves coordinating with creative, technical, and marketing teams to plan and track the progress of campaigns and projects. You'll review timelines, set priorities, manage resources, and ensure deliverables align with established goals and client expectations. Regular communication with stakeholders, analyzing campaign metrics, and problem-solving to overcome project roadblocks are also essential parts of the role. This position offers a fast-paced, collaborative environment where you'll balance multiple projects and have opportunities to grow into senior leadership positions over time.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a digital marketing project manager?

To thrive as a Digital Marketing Project Manager, you need expertise in digital marketing strategies, project management methodologies, and a relevant degree or certification such as PMP or a digital marketing credential. Familiarity with tools like Google Analytics, project management software (e.g., Asana, Trello), and marketing automation platforms (e.g., HubSpot, Marketo) is typically required. Excellent organizational skills, adaptability, and clear communication help set you apart in leading cross-functional teams and ensuring project goals are met. These competencies are crucial for successfully driving campaigns from conception to completion, achieving business objectives, and efficiently managing resources in a dynamic digital landscape.

Job description

Position Summary:
The Digital Marketing Specialist supports the execution, administration, and continuous improvement of Graton Resort & Casino's digital guest experience platforms and marketing technology initiatives. This position works closely with the Digital Guest Experience Manager, IT, Rewards, Database Marketing, external vendors, and internal stakeholders to coordinate digital projects, manage website and application content, execute digital communications, and maintain guest-facing digital experiences.
The Digital Marketing Specialist is responsible for content management, project coordination, quality assurance, campaign deployment, and reporting across digital channels including website, mobile applications, email, SMS, push notifications, and other guest engagement platforms. This role serves as a key operational resource, helping ensure digital experiences are accurate, engaging, compliant, and aligned with business objectives.
As an exempt position, this role requires flexibility to support business-critical digital initiatives, technology implementations, promotions, and guest communications that may occasionally occur during evenings, weekends, or holidays.
Essential Functions:
1. Responsible for redefining hospitality at Graton Resort & Casino while living, supporting, and promoting our values.
2. Perform responsibilities in accordance with all Graton Resort & Casino standards, policies, and procedures.
3. Maintain and update guest-facing digital content across Graton Resort & Casino's website, mobile applications, player portals, and other digital experience platforms.
4. Ensure all digital content, communications, promotions, and guest-facing information are accurate, current, compliant, and aligned with Graton Resort & Casino branding standards.
5. Build, schedule, test, and deploy digital communications including:
a. Email campaigns
b. SMS communications
c. Push notifications
d. In-app messaging
6. Coordinate messaging assets, approvals, audience requirements, creative deliverables, and deployment schedules with Marketing, Rewards, Database Marketing, Operations, and external vendors.
7. Perform quality assurance reviews for digital content, website updates, mobile app content, messaging campaigns, promotions, and technology enhancements to ensure accuracy and proper functionality.
8. Monitor email, SMS, push notification, and in-app messaging performance and assist with ongoing reporting, analysis, and optimization efforts.
9. Coordinate digital projects, platform enhancements, and technology initiatives by managing timelines, deliverables, testing requirements, stakeholder communications, and launch activities.
10. Support website, mobile application, and digital platform administration utilizing content management systems, including WordPress and other digital publishing tools.
11. Work proactively with the Digital Guest Experience Manager, IT teams, business stakeholders, and vendors to support the implementation and continuous improvement of digital guest experience initiatives.
12. Participate in user acceptance testing (UAT), launch readiness activities, platform validation, issue tracking, and post-launch support for digital projects and technology enhancements.
13. Maintain project documentation, meeting notes, implementation plans, digital inventories, deployment schedules, and operational process documentation.
14. Develop strong relationships with internal and external teams to drive collaboration, ensure successful project execution, and support ongoing digital transformation initiatives.
15. Support digital campaign launches, technology implementations, platform updates, and guest-facing initiatives that may occur during evenings, weekends, holidays, or other non-standard business hours as business needs require.
